Every human being has to go through the search and struggle of wondering who God made them to be and for what purpose. No one is excluded. But, God put it within your DNA, the hunger and desire to search for Him and His reason for our life’s purpose. And within our search, God works to reveal Himself to you through His Word and His Holy Spirit living within you! 

In Part One of this two-part devotional on discovering who God really made you to be, we read in from Hosea 14:1-2 (NLT2) where God revealed the answer to that question, and in many other places in the Bible. He started speaking to the Israelites—His people by addressing them saying… “O Israel…” Those words mean far more than what appears on the surface. Those words were powerful words which mean the power and strength to rule as God. When God was saying “O Israel” he was saying You who I’ve called to rule the earth in the strength of God. But there is even more to the meaning than that. They also mean the people who I established a covenant with and gave power and strength to influence this world in God’s ways for all generations! Think about that! That is what God named these people! He called them to be powerful influencers! Why? Because they were to become His leaders to influence all of mankind to learn and know God.  They were to be a light to all people. The ones to show them God’s love, His ways, and God’s power in this earth.”

Just like anyone might, they had trouble grasping that God would use anyone to that degree. They approached discovering who they were supposed to be like anyone else. They looked in the mirror and inside themselves for their answers. But, what most saw was that they were ordinary sinners who weren’t capable of much more than becoming like every other people group they were surrounded by. They were caught up in their sin, weaknesses, and failures, and in the cultures around them, and in their own daily pressures of life. Instead of representing God with lives of power and influence, they lived self-centered mediocre lives filled with sin and complacency with their only  purpose being to survive. They became a despised people and became a joke to the world.

What did God say to them regarding all this? “O Israel, return to the LORD your God, for you have stumbled because of your iniquity…” God was crying out for them to come back to be who He created them to be. He then said, “Take words with you, And return to the LORD…” Take words means take my counsel. He told them, “Return to Me.” He then told them how. He said to pray, “Take away all iniquity; Receive us graciously.” God is the one who at this point said, “Ask me to take away your sins and receive me by my grace.” Grace is the undeserved blessing of God given from His heart of love and mercy as a free gift. He wanted to grace them with forgiveness so they could move forward as His influencers in the earth.

He then told them one more powerful thing to do. He told them to say, “For we will offer the sacrifice of our lips.” That meant they would begin to praise Him for everything He was, for everything He had done in the past for His people, and for all He yet promised to do. Why was this important? Because this praise would help stir them to want to know more about their purpose and heritage!

“Who am I?” is further answered in Psalms 95:7 NIV which says, “For He is our God; and we are the people of His pasture, and the sheep of His hand. Today if you will hear His voice.”

If Jesus has become your Lord, then like Israel, you are His people. You aren’t just another guy or gal on the block or in the workplace. You are someone who God established a covenant with through Jesus Christ.  You are someone whom through His Holy Spirit, gives you power within to say Yes to what is good and right and No to what isn’t. You are someone He gave the power and strength to become an influencer and world changer. That is who we are in Christ. Is that hard for you to believe? Most things God reveals to us about who we are in Him, are astounding to believe. Do you think Noah wasn’t astounded? Do you think Moses wasn’t astounded? Do you think Abraham wasn’t astounded? We are all astounded at the thought that God wants to use us. But it’s true and the only way you will get to know who you really are! And the rest of your story is summed up in these next verses! 

Acts 26:16-18 (NIV) “Now get up and stand on your feet. I have appeared to you to appoint you as a servant and as a witness of what you have seen of me and what I will show you. I will rescue you from your own people…. I am sending you to them to open their eyes and turn them from darkness to light, and from the power of Satan to God, so that they may receive forgiveness of sins and a place among those who are sanctified by faith in me.”  So… It’s time to take your place. Now you know who you are to be. Now you know the path to get there. And now you know that God is in covenant with you—something He cannot break or leave unfilled. This is who He has called you to be.
